# How are funding rates calculated?

**Regular Trading Hours:** The perpetual funding rate is calculated from two components:

* the premium component (perpetual contract vs. underlying)
* added to a base component (fixed at SOFR + 0.5%)

During regular hours, the premium is sampled continuously by comparing the price of the perpetual contract vs. the price of the underlying asset.

**Outside Regular Trading Hours:** The rate snaps to the fixed financing rate (SOFR + 0.5%) and the basis component is dropped:

* so positions held overnight or over a weekend don't face shifting funding.

**Corporate actions:** these trigger separate automatic adjustments when the oracle reflects the event, keeping the perp aligned with the underlying's total return.
